Jeffrey Sayer is an academic researcher from University of British Columbia. The author has contributed to research in topics: Sustainable development & Biodiversity. The author has an hindex of 50, co-authored 188 publications receiving 11063 citations. Previous affiliations of Jeffrey Sayer include Utrecht University & Center for International Forestry Research.
